Can I start a home e-commerce / online store from home in Myrtle Beach?
Yes, Myrtle Beach generally allows home occupations including home e-commerce / online store, subject to the city's standard restrictions (25% floor area, 1 non-resident employees, etc.). A home occupation permit is required.
What permits do I need for a home e-commerce / online store in Myrtle Beach, SC?
You'll typically need: 1) A home occupation permit from Myrtle Beach ($50), 2) A general business license, 3) Any applicable state professional licenses. Contact the city planning department to confirm.
